Abstract

Vor dem Abdrücken von mehreren Abteilungen (1 bis 10) eines Verbandes (VB) über den Ablaufgipfel (AG) einer Ablaufanlage wird zunächst in bekannter Weise für jede Abteilung (1 bis 10) eine abteilungsindividuelle höchstzulässige Abdrückgeschwindigkeit (vo) bestimmt.
Nach dem jeweils vorhergehenden Ablauf (1) wird aus den höchstzulässigen Abdrückgeschwindigkeiten (vo) aller verbleibenden, noch abzudrückenden Abteilungen (2 bis 10) die geringste höchstzulässige Abdrückgeschwindigkeit ermittelt. Diese wird als Abdrückgeschwindigkeit (vzulneu) für den nachfolgenden Ablauf (2) vorgegeben.
